EFM32微控制器:ARM Cortex-M3低功耗技术新突破

5星 · 超过95%的资源 需积分: 9 43 下载量 200 浏览量 更新于2024-07-31 1 收藏 7.15MB PDF 举报
"EFM32 datasheet - EFM32GMicrocontrollerFamily的初步参考手册,专注于ARM Cortex-M3核的32位低功耗微控制器" EFM32系列微控制器是基于ARM Cortex-M3处理器核心的一款产品,旨在提供高性能与超低功耗的完美结合,特别适用于8位到32位的市场。该系列微控制器以其在运行模式下仅为180μA/MHz的极低功耗而脱颖而出,显著优于市面上的8位、16位和32位解决方案。 EFM32G家族的核心是32位的Cortex-M3处理器,工作频率最高可达32MHz,提供了卓越的计算性能。同时,它配备了高达128KB的闪存和16KB的RAM内存,满足了各种复杂应用的需求。为了实现高效能和低能耗,这些微控制器包含了自主且能源效率极高的外设,如高速缓存、定时器、串行通信接口等。 在低功耗设计方面,EFM32G微控制器具备创新的超低能量模式,可在待机状态下实现亚微安级的运行。这极大地延长了电池供电设备的使用寿命,使得系统电池可以维持工作数年。其特有的能源模式包括深度睡眠模式和待机模式,这些模式下系统能够快速唤醒,同时保持极低的功耗。 除了硬件特性,EFM32G还具有高度集成的模拟和数字功能,如模拟比较器、ADC(模数转换器)、DAC(数模转换器)和电源管理模块。这些集成的组件减少了外部组件的需求,降低了系统的总体成本,并简化了设计过程。 此外,EFM32G微控制器家族的软件支持也是其强大之处,通常包括全面的开发工具链,如嵌入式实时操作系统(RTOS)、调试工具以及丰富的库函数,这些都方便开发者进行应用程序的编写和优化。 EFM32G系列微控制器是设计者实现高能效、低功耗应用的理想选择,尤其适合于那些对电池寿命有严格要求的物联网(IoT)设备、穿戴设备、远程传感器节点以及其他需要长时间工作的便携式设备。通过利用其独特的能源管理模式和强大的处理能力,开发人员可以创建出既节能又具备高性能特性的产品。